Get Shinier Hair Naturally; Use These 13 Tips

Having naturally healthy, shiny hair is much easier said than done. Sure, after visiting a salon, you may be feeling proud of your gorgeous locks, but achieving the same results at home is much more difficult. 

If you’ve been desperately trying to find ways to get shinier hair at home, you’re not alone. Many of us struggle with far more bad hair days than we would like. Unfortunately, most people give up on trying to achieve beautiful, shiny hair at home, but with a little effort and the right approach, it’s perfectly doable. 

Living with dry unhappy hair isn’t pleasant. So, if you’ve been struggling with your hair, here are 13 tips and good habits you can adopt to give you shiny, healthy hair that looks and feels amazing.  

Brush Your Hair Regularly

A lot of people have heard that brushing your hair too much is bad for it. However, regular brushing helps to improve blood circulation, leading to shinier locks. Furthermore, it ensures that all the proper nutrients are delivered to the hair follicles. Just make sure you use the right type of brush for your particular hair type and avoid being overly vigorous with brushing hair when wet, as this can lead to breakage. 

Choose An Oil Treatment

Oil treatments are beneficial for helping out dull, dry, rough hair. They help to lock in and maintain moisture, leading to soft, shiny hair. Put coconut or almond oil on your hair and scalp every two to three days. Make sure you use a circular motion to rub it onto your scalp. Leave the oil treatment on for at least 30 minutes, and then rinse it off.

Lay Off the Heat

You’re probably already aware of this, but heat is horrible for your hair. At all costs, avoid frequent heat styling, particularly without the use of a heat protectant. Hair can become extremely dry from frequently using a blow dryer, straightener, or curling iron, which strips away the natural shine. Fortunately, there are alternative options to heat styling, such as using leave-in curlers instead of a curling iron. 

Make Use of a Hair Mask

Hair can be made to look incredible by using a hair mask on a weekly basis. It is possible to improve the shine of your hair by using a nourishing and softening mask. There are plenty of great hair masks available on the market, or if you want to go the all-natural route, you can make your own at home using ingredients such as coconut oil. Plus, applying a hair mask can be relaxing and make a great addition to your weekly self-care routine.

Rinse With Cold Water

You might cringe at the thought of having a cold shower, but cold water is said to constrict pores, which seals the hair cuticle, adds shine, and locks in moisture. Of course, you don’t have to suffer through an entirely cold shower; just make sure you rinse your shampoo and conditioner out with cold water at the very end. 

Be Wary of Coloring Your Hair

There’s no doubt about it, coloring or bleaching your hair is a great way to have some fun. Unfortunately, it’s not the best thing for the health of your hair. Some ingredients can cause your hair to become dry, brittle, and coarse, particularly for those who are bleaching their hair to a lighter color. Ingredients in most hair dyes, such as ammonia, are very damaging. Avoid regularly bleaching or dying your hair to keep it healthy and shiny. If you do color your hair, make sure to use a high-quality shampoo and conditioner made for colored hair. 

Try A Hair Gloss

Just as with many other treatments, a good hair gloss helps to seal in moisture and close the hair cuticles, leaving your locks softer, shinier, and frizz-free. Also, a hair gloss can work wonders for reducing brassy tones in blonde or bleached hair.

Ditch Old Fashioned Hair Sprays

Get rid of those awful old hair sprays that leave your locks feeling stiff and dry, and choose something that lets your hair flow naturally. You can still lock your hairstyle in place without ruining the sleek, shiny, healthy look you’re going for. These days, your hair can be held in place with a good hairspray that leaves it shiny without making it feel or look dull and sticky.

Don’t Shampoo Too Often

You might have heard this one before, but shampooing too often gets rid of the hair’s natural oils, which can leave your hair dehydrated and cause your scalp to produce excessive oil to compensate. This leads to dry, dull, brittle ends and roots that turn oily much faster than normal. By allowing natural oils to stay in the hair for a longer time, you can keep it hydrated and bolster that all-important shine. At most, shampoo your hair three times a week but twice is even better.

Opt For a Serum

In addition to enhancing hair shine, hair serums make your hair silky smooth and touchably soft. Argan oil is one option popular with a growing number of people, but there are many other serums on the market too. When applying, brush it through your hair and make sure you don’t overdo it.

Consume Omega-3

Consuming more foods with omega-3 fatty acids is one habit you can adopt to help your hair stay healthy and shiny in the long run. Foods like fish, nuts, and seeds contain omega-3s. Your hair will feel rejuvenated, glossy, and will benefit greatly from these polyunsaturated fatty acids.
